A10A Graphic Illustrator Journeyman
A Navy Enlisted Classification: a skill designation sailors hold in addition to their rating.
Overview
A Graphic Illustrator Journeyman creates and edits artwork, imagery, captions, identification numbers, and archived data and image files using design and layout principles. They work with raster and vector graphics, desktop publishing, image editing, electronic presentations, web design, animation, and digitized audio and video software.
Minimum clearance: Secret

What the Work Involves
- Key information into computer equipment to create layouts for client or supervisor.
- Review final layouts and suggest improvements, as needed.
- Determine size and arrangement of illustrative material and copy, and select style and size of type.
- Develop graphics and layouts for product illustrations, company logos, and Web sites.
- Create designs, concepts, and sample layouts, based on knowledge of layout principles and esthetic design concepts.
